noun

Meaning 1

A word, phrase or grammatical phenomenon typical of the Finnish language, when used in another language.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: countable, uncountable

Examples

  • ...extensive use of fennicisms is often considered to be a sign of eroding Swedish language skills...
  • Another difference between the literary usage of Soviet Estonia and émigré Estonians lies in the use of Fennicisms

noun

Meaning 2

The influence of the Finnish language on another language, especially on Finland Swedish.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: uncountable
